Receptor-Guided Targeted Protein Degradation Collapses Extracellular Vesicle-Driven Tumor-Stroma Crosstalk
Abstract Extracellular vesicles (EVs) are critical mediators of tumor-stromal communication within the tumor microenvironment (TME), where reciprocal signaling between cancer cells and cancer-associated fibroblasts (CAFs) fuels malignant progression and therapeutic resistance. Here, we report a degrader-antibody conjugate (DAC) platform, Ctx-ETAC, in which the clinically approved anti-EGFR antibody cetuximab (Ctx) delivers an engineered proteolysis-targeting chimera (PROTAC) payload, ETAC, selectively into EGFR-expressing tumor cells and activated CAFs via receptor-mediated endocytosis. ETAC integrates indomethacin as the COX-2 ligand, a VHL-recruiting peptide, and a cathepsin B (Cat-B)-cleavable azidoacetyl-RR linker; conjugation to Ctx was achieved by a two-step bioorthogonal strategy, yielding an average drug-to-antibody ratio of 4.21. The resulting Ctx-ETAC ensures biomarker-selective payload activation in both tumor cells and activated CAFs, markedly reducing EV secretion by 95.5% and thereby disrupting their crosstalk. This disruption of EV-mediated communication reprograms CAFs toward a quiescent phenotype and reshapes the non-small cell lung cancer microenvironment into an antitumor state. In a xenograft model, Ctx-ETAC achieves markedly superior tumor suppression compared with Ctx monotherapy, without systemic toxicity. These findings establish receptor-guided targeted protein degradation as a strategy to disrupt EV-driven tumor-stromal communication and provide a new framework for microenvironment-directed cancer therapy.
